European Commission to Allow Farm Buy-Outs to Reduce Nitrogen Pollution

05/08/2023

Margrethe Vestager, Executive Vice President of the European Commission responsible for Competition Policy has approved a scheme to buy-out farmers in Holland.  Approval of this strategy was required to distinguish the program from a subsidy that would be disallowed. The objective of buying out at least a third of the farms in Holland is to reduce nitrogen emission from CAFO's and family operated dairy units.

 

The LTO in Holland analogous to the Farm Bureau Federation in the U.S. will require that buy- outs should be "designed in such a way that they really offer farmers who voluntarily cease operation the opportunity to end their businesses".  The LTO is also advocating transition schemes to allow farmers to reduce nitrogen emission through applying technology or conversion from dairy production to other livestock or agricultural activities.
